Q: What is an x-ray machine used for? A: An x-ray machine is used to produce images of the internal structures of the body, helping doctors detect fractures, infections, and other medical conditions. Q: How does an x-ray machine work? A:X-ray machine emit controlled radiation that passes through the body and records varying degrees of absorption on detectors or film, creating visual images of bones and tissues. Q: Is it safe to use an x-ray machine frequently? A: Modern x-ray machines use very low doses of radiation, and protective measures such as lead aprons help minimize exposure for both patients and operators. Q: Can an x-ray machine detect soft tissue injuries? A: Although X-rays machine are primarily used to examine bones, they can reveal some soft tissue abnormalities, especially when used with contrast agents or digital image enhancement techniques. Q: Who operates an x-ray machine? A: X-ray machines are typically operated by trained radiologic technologists who ensure correct positioning, exposure settings, and safety protocols during imaging.
